Israel’s military says it’s striking Hezbollah sites as Netanyahu vows to ‘increase the blows’
Israel's military struck Hezbollah sites in Lebanon's Bekaa Valley as Prime Minister Benjamin Netanyahu pledged to intensify attacks against the group. Hezbollah has been using fiber optic drones to target Israeli forces, escalating tensions despite a U.S.-brokered ceasefire. The U.S. State Department criticized Hezbollah for violating the ceasefire and called for disarming the Iran-backed group.
